Smart Notebook Text Overlaps

Have you ever experienced the frustration of trying to write neatly in your smart notebook, only to find that the text overlaps or becomes illegible? This common issue can make using a smart notebook a lot less enjoyable. But fear not, there are solutions to this problem that can help you make the most out of your note-taking experience.

One reason why text overlaps in smart notebooks is due to the sensitivity settings of the device. When the sensitivity is set too high, the notebook may pick up unintended movements of the pen, causing the text to overlap. To resolve this, try adjusting the sensitivity settings in the app or software that accompanies your smart notebook. By fine-tuning this setting, you can reduce the likelihood of text overlapping and ensure that your handwriting appears clear and legible on the digital screen.

Another factor that can contribute to text overlap is the speed at which you write. If you write too quickly, the smart notebook may struggle to keep up with your hand movements, resulting in overlapping text. To combat this, try slowing down your writing pace slightly and giving the device a moment to capture each stroke accurately. This small adjustment can make a big difference in preventing text overlap and improving the overall quality of your notes.

Additionally, the type of pen or stylus you use with your smart notebook can also impact text overlap. Low-quality or worn-out pens may produce inconsistent lines or irregularities that can lead to overlapping text. Consider investing in a high-quality pen or stylus that is specifically designed for use with smart notebooks. This can help minimize text overlap and ensure a smooth writing experience.

Furthermore, it's essential to maintain your smart notebook properly to prevent text overlap issues. Regularly calibrating the device, keeping the screen clean, and updating the software can all contribute to a better user experience. By taking care of your smart notebook and following manufacturer recommendations, you can minimize the chances of text overlap and other common issues.
